Medicine Administration Approaches
While taking care of everyday tasks and health and wellness monitoring, reliable medication management is basic for people getting home care. Caregivers play a vital role in organizing and administering drugs to assure adherence to suggested regimens. Using pill organizers can streamline the procedure, permitting caregivers to easily track dosages and timetables. Normal interaction with doctor is crucial for addressing any kind of worries or adjustments in drugs. Furthermore, caregivers need to preserve a detailed medicine log, documenting dosages and times administered, which can help prevent mistakes. Educating customers regarding their medicines fosters understanding and conformity. By implementing these methods, caregivers can significantly add to the total health and well-being of their liked ones, reducing the risk of medication-related difficulties.
Health Status Tracking
Reliable health status tracking is important for caregivers as they take care of the day-to-day activities and health tracking of individuals in home care. By systematically videotaping essential signs, drug timetables, and behavioral modifications, caregivers can identify possible wellness concerns early. This proactive approach permits for prompt interventions, guaranteeing that doctor can change care strategies as needed. What Is the Ordinary Expense of Home Care Services?
The typical cost of home care services varies widely, generally varying from $20 to $50 per hour, depending upon area, service type, and caregiver certifications, influencing family members' choices pertaining to long-lasting care solutions for their enjoyed ones.
Exactly how Do I Handle Caregiver Burnout?
Resolving caretaker burnout calls for acknowledging stress signs, developing borders, looking for support, and making use of reprieve services. Normal self-care tasks, open interaction with loved ones, and specialist counseling can additionally greatly reduce emotional and physical pressure.
